BS IEC 60911:2025 - Ensuring Safety and Efficiency in Nuclear Power Plants

Introducing the BS IEC 60911:2025, a comprehensive standard designed to enhance the safety and operational efficiency of nuclear power plants. This essential document focuses on the instrumentation systems and measurements necessary for monitoring adequate cooling within the core of pressurized light water reactors.
